The cumulative impact of tariff policy changes in the United States through 2025 has added layers of complexity to how multinational enterprises think about intellectual property strategy and operational deployment. Tariff shifts influence supply chain design, cost structures, and the relative attractiveness of certain jurisdictions for manufacturing and R&D. When production footprints and component sourcing change in response to tariffs, patent enforcement and monetization strategies must adapt accordingly, since jurisdictional patent value can diverge from historical expectations as commercial exposure shifts.
Organizations are responding by integrating tariff and trade considerations into patent portfolio prioritization. Patent families tied to products that face higher import duties may receive re-prioritized prosecution or enforcement attention if the underlying revenue streams are materially affected. At the same time, legal and commercial teams are collaborating more closely with supply chain and trade specialists to model joint scenarios that capture both customs impacts and IP risks. These cross-disciplinary assessments inform decisions about where to file, how aggressively to assert rights, and which licensing strategies are most appropriate in a shifting trade environment. As a result, patent management is becoming more tightly coupled with global operations and trade planning, with the objective of maintaining flexibility and protecting commercial value across changing policy regimes.
A segmentation-driven perspective reveals how solution design, service delivery, deployment preferences, organizational scale, and industry context collectively shape the expectations and requirements for enterprise patent management offerings. When based on solution, product roadmaps typically differentiate around integration capabilities and the depth of lifecycle coverage, spanning Integration to support connection with enterprise systems, Licensing modules to administer transactions and contracts, Maintenance tools to track annuities and deadlines, and Upgrades that enhance analytics and user experience. In practice, organizations seeking tight ERP and R&D integration will emphasize Integration and Upgrades, while those focused on cost control may prioritize Maintenance capabilities.
Based on service, the market fragments by consultative expertise, operational outsourcing, and capacity building, where Consulting Services deliver strategic support across Patent Valuation, Portfolio Strategy, and Regulatory Compliance, Managed Services take responsibility for critical functions such as Annuity Management, Docketing Services, and Record Management, and Training Services build internal proficiency through User Training and Workshop Sessions. Clients with limited internal IP resources commonly pair Managed Services for day-to-day reliability with Consulting Services for strategic clarity, complemented by Training Services that ensure knowledge transfer and sustained adoption.
Based on deployment model, preferences oscillate between Cloud and On Premise implementations, with cloud solutions often favored for scalability, remote collaboration, and frequent functional updates, while on premise remains relevant where data residency, integration complexity, or legacy system constraints dictate tighter control. Based on enterprise size, large enterprises seek enterprise-grade configurability, multi-jurisdictional workflows, and robust reporting to support complex portfolios, whereas small and medium enterprises focus on streamlined processes, cost-effective support, and rapid time-to-value. Finally, based on industry, domain-specific needs differ markedly: healthcare organizations demand rigorous compliance and clinical integration, information technology firms prioritize speed to protect software and platform innovations, legal practices emphasize docketing accuracy and case management, and manufacturing enterprises require strong linkage between patents and product development cycles. Together these segmentation lenses inform procurement criteria, implementation roadmaps, and ongoing service models for successful patent management initiatives.
Regional dynamics materially influence how organizations structure patent management programs, as regulatory environments, litigation ecosystems, and innovation hubs vary across geographies and shape strategic priorities. In the Americas, organizations often contend with sophisticated enforcement regimes and a litigious commercial environment that elevates the importance of granular docketing, evidence preservation, and alignment between litigation counsel and in-house IP teams. Meanwhile, commercial strategies in this region place a premium on licensing frameworks and monetization pathways that reflect diverse market opportunities.
In Europe, Middle East & Africa, the landscape is heterogeneous: fragmented patent systems across multiple jurisdictions necessitate nuanced filing strategies and region-specific compliance approaches, and businesses frequently balance central European enforcement mechanisms against local market entry considerations. This region also presents growing opportunities for cross-border collaboration and harmonized technical standards, which has implications for how patent teams prioritize coordination across legal, regulatory, and commercial functions. In the Asia-Pacific region, the pace of innovation and manufacturing scale drives a focus on rapid filing, operational integration with production footprints, and proactive freedom-to-operate assessments. Firms operating in Asia-Pacific commonly emphasize strategic filings tied to manufacturing and supplier networks and invest in local counsel relationships to navigate diverse administrative practices. Across all regions, the need for interoperable systems and consistent governance models supports global visibility while enabling local execution tailored to regional legal and commercial realities.

For industry leaders seeking to strengthen patent management as a competitive asset, actionable recommendations emphasize pragmatic investments and governance reforms that deliver early returns while enabling scaling. First, align patent strategy explicitly with business objectives by defining the value drivers-whether defensive protection, licensing revenue, or freedom-to-operate assurance-and by creating decision gates that map prosecution choices to commercial outcomes. This alignment reduces wasteful filings and directs resources toward high-impact families. Second, establish cross-functional operating rhythms that bring legal, R&D, product, and finance stakeholders into recurring portfolio reviews so invention capture and patent decisions are informed by market and technical priorities.
Third, prioritize data integration and automation to eliminate manual handoffs and to surface timely signals for patent valuation and risk assessment. Automation of annuity management and docketing reduces administrative risk and frees specialized staff to focus on strategic tasks. Fourth, adopt a hybrid delivery model that balances managed services for routine execution with in-house strategic capabilities, ensuring continuity while preserving institutional knowledge. Fifth, invest in targeted training programs and workshops to raise internal proficiency and to institutionalize best practices across teams. Finally, maintain a disciplined program for measuring outcomes tied to governance objectives-track improvements in process cycle times, enforcement readiness, and cross-functional decision effectiveness to demonstrate the contribution of patent management to broader enterprise goals.
